Shingle roofing cost by grade.

Installed prices for a full shingle replacement in Monmouth Junction. Roofers quote per square (100 sq ft) — a typical single-family roof runs 17–25 squares.

  • 3-tab shingles
    Flat profile, 15–20 year typical service
    $5,600 – $10,500
  • Architectural shingles
    Dimensional, 25–30 year — the U.S. default
    $8,100 – $16,000
  • Designer / premium shingles
    Slate and shake look-alikes
    $12,000 – $25,500
  • Underlayment & ice barrier
    Synthetic felt, ice & water shield where code requires
    $500 – $2,000
  • Deck repair (plywood)
    Replacing rotted sheathing, priced by extent
    $500 – $2,500
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Old layers off, dumpster included
    $1,000 – $3,000
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$250 – $1,000

* Adjusted for Monmouth Junction's labor market — an on-site measure sets the square count.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Monmouth Junction.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Cost factors

Why Shingle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Monmouth Junction

Several factors unique to Monmouth Junction influence shingle roof replacement costs. The local climate—including hail, high winds from coastal storms, and UV exposure—can dictate the type of shingles needed. New Jersey's building code requires specific underlayment and ice-and-water shield in certain areas, which adds to material costs. Labor rates in central New Jersey are higher than national averages due to demand and cost of living. The age and style of your home matter: older homes may need decking repairs, while newer subdivisions with complex roof lines require more labor. Disposal fees for old shingles and permit costs from the local building department also contribute to the final price.

Field notes

Common Issues

  1. Hail Damage

    Monmouth Junction experiences hailstorms that can bruise asphalt shingles, reducing their lifespan and often necessitating full replacement rather than spot repairs.

  2. Wind Uplift

    Nor'easters and thunderstorms bring strong winds that can lift shingle edges, causing them to curl or tear off. Over time, this leads to leaks and replacement needs.

  3. UV Degradation

    The region's sunny summers cause UV rays to break down asphalt shingles, making them brittle and prone to cracking. This is common on south-facing slopes.

  4. Ice Dams

    Snow accumulation and freeze-thaw cycles in Monmouth Junction can create ice dams along eaves, forcing water under shingles and damaging the roof deck.

  5. Algae Growth

    Humid conditions promote algae growth on asphalt shingles, causing dark streaks. While not immediately damaging, it indicates moisture retention that can shorten shingle life.

Q&A

Shingle Roof cost questions — Monmouth Junction

What factors affect shingle roof replacement cost in Monmouth Junction?

Costs depend on roof size, slope, complexity, and the type of shingles chosen. Local building code requirements (like ice-and-water shield) add to material costs. Labor rates in central New Jersey are higher than many other areas. Disposal fees and permit costs from the local building department also play a role. The condition of the roof deck—whether it needs repairs—can increase the total.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Monmouth Junction?

Look for a contractor licensed in New Jersey, with proof of insurance and local references. Ask about their experience with asphalt shingle roofs and whether they handle permits. Get multiple written estimates and compare the scope of work, not just price. Check online reviews and the Better Business Bureau. Avoid contractors who ask for large upfront payments.

What are New Jersey's licensing requirements for roofers?

New Jersey requires home improvement contractors to register with the Division of Consumer Affairs. Roofers must also carry liability insurance and workers' compensation. There is no state-level roofing license, but local building departments may have additional requirements. Always verify a contractor's registration and insurance before hiring.

When is the ideal time to replace a shingle roof in Monmouth Junction?

Late spring through early fall offers the most consistent weather for roof replacement. Temperatures are moderate, and rain is less frequent. Avoid winter months when cold temperatures can affect shingle sealing. However, contractors may have more availability in the off-season. Plan ahead to schedule during favorable weather.

Do I need a permit for a shingle roof replacement in Monmouth Junction?

Yes, most roof replacements require a permit from the local building department. The contractor typically handles this, but you should confirm. Permits ensure the work meets New Jersey's building code. Failing to pull a permit can cause issues when selling your home. Ask your contractor about permit fees and inspection requirements.
